Herramientas para Desarrolladores Los mejores de la categoría 1 results Información Herramienta de IA

Las herramientas de IA populares en el campo de Herramientas para Desarrolladores para Información incluyen Zeli, etc., que le ayudan a mejorar rápidamente la eficiencia.

Gratis
Zeli

Zeli

Zeli es una plataforma impulsada por IA que traduce y resume las principales noticias tecnológicas de Hacker News …

35.7K

Acerca de Información

Las herramientas de información son soluciones impulsadas por IA diseñadas para ayudar a los desarrolladores a acceder, procesar y sintetizar de manera eficiente grandes volúmenes de datos y conocimientos. Estas herramientas aprovechan el procesamiento avanzado del lenguaje natural, el aprendizaje automático y los algoritmos de búsqueda inteligente para transformar datos brutos y no estructurados en información procesable. Optimizan tareas críticas de desarrollo como la comprensión de código, el análisis automatizado de documentación y la supervisión proactiva del sistema, lo que permite a los desarrolladores tomar decisiones más rápidas e informadas a lo largo del ciclo de vida del desarrollo de software y mejorar la productividad general.

Características Principales

  • Búsqueda Inteligente de Código: Comprende el contexto y la intención del código, proporcionando fragmentos de código y ejemplos relevantes más allá de la simple coincidencia de palabras clave.
  • Análisis Automatizado de Documentación: Resume documentos técnicos complejos, extrae información clave y responde preguntas específicas de grandes bases de conocimiento.
  • Reconocimiento de Patrones en Registros y Datos: Utiliza IA para identificar anomalías, tendencias y eventos críticos dentro de los registros del sistema, métricas y datos operativos.
  • Generación de Grafos de Conocimiento: Construye automáticamente representaciones de conocimiento estructuradas a partir de texto no estructurado, vinculando conceptos y entidades relacionadas para una mejor comprensión.
  • Recuperación Semántica de Información: Va más allá de las palabras clave para comprender el significado y el contexto de las consultas, entregando resultados más precisos y relevantes de diversas fuentes de datos.

Escenarios de Aplicación

Los desarrolladores a menudo tienen dificultades para navegar por grandes bases de código, comprender comportamientos complejos del sistema o encontrar información específica dispersa en varias fuentes de documentación. Las herramientas de información impulsadas por IA son cruciales para acelerar la incorporación, la depuración y el desarrollo de funciones al proporcionar acceso inteligente y consciente del contexto a información crítica del proyecto y del sistema.

Cómo Elegir

Al seleccionar herramientas de información impulsadas por IA, considere los tipos específicos de datos que necesita procesar (por ejemplo, código, registros, texto), la precisión y relevancia de sus modelos de IA, y sus capacidades de integración con los flujos de trabajo de desarrollo existentes (IDEs, CI/CD). Evalúe sus capacidades de comprensión del lenguaje natural, la escalabilidad con su volumen de datos y la facilidad para personalizar su base de conocimiento para sus necesidades específicas.

InformaciónEscenario de uso

1

Acelerar la Incorporación a Bases de Código

Los nuevos desarrolladores utilizan herramientas de información de IA para comprender rápidamente bases de código grandes y desconocidas, consultando el código semánticamente, identificando funciones clave y comprendiendo las dependencias. Esto reduce significativamente el tiempo de adaptación, permitiéndoles contribuir eficazmente mucho antes que con la exploración manual.

2

Depuración y Resolución de Problemas Inteligente

Los desarrolladores aprovechan la IA para analizar registros de errores, métricas del sistema e informes de incidentes, identificando automáticamente las causas raíz, sugiriendo soluciones o señalando documentación relevante y soluciones anteriores. Esto acelera la resolución de problemas, minimizando el tiempo de inactividad y mejorando la fiabilidad del sistema.

3

Automatizar Preguntas y Respuestas de Documentación API

Los equipos de desarrollo implementan herramientas de IA que pueden responder preguntas complejas sobre APIs y servicios internos basándose en su documentación, reduciendo la necesidad de soporte humano directo y mejorando el autoservicio del desarrollador. Esto libera a los desarrolladores senior para que se centren en tareas más complejas.

4

Extraer Requisitos de Datos No Estructurados

Los gerentes de producto y desarrolladores utilizan la IA para analizar comentarios de usuarios, tickets de soporte y documentos de investigación de mercado, extrayendo automáticamente solicitudes de funciones, puntos débiles y sentimientos para informar el desarrollo del producto. Esto asegura que las hojas de ruta del producto estén basadas en datos y alineadas con las necesidades del usuario.

5

Mantener Bases de Conocimiento Internas Actualizadas

Los equipos utilizan la IA para escanear y actualizar continuamente wikis internas, documentos de diseño y especificaciones técnicas, asegurando que todos los miembros del equipo tengan acceso a la información más actual y relevante sin curación manual. Esto reduce los silos de información y garantiza la coherencia entre proyectos.

6

Búsqueda Semántica de Recursos Técnicos

Los ingenieros emplean motores de búsqueda impulsados por IA para encontrar artículos técnicos, trabajos de investigación o proyectos de código abierto altamente específicos en internet o repositorios internos, comprendiendo la intención detrás de sus consultas en lugar de solo palabras clave. Esto mejora significativamente la relevancia y velocidad del descubrimiento de información para desafíos técnicos complejos.

InformaciónPreguntas frecuentes